SB217,1,2 1An Act to amend 23.33 (3) (em) and 23.33 (6r) of the statutes; relating to:
2passenger restrictions on all-terrain vehicles.
Analysis by the Legislative Reference Bureau
Under current law, it is unlawful to ride on an all-terrain vehicle (ATV) or
utility terrain vehicle (UTV) on a part of the ATV or UTV that is not designed for use
by passengers. It is also unlawful to operate an ATV or UTV with such a passenger.
This bill provides that these restrictions do not apply to an ATV with one passenger
in a second seated position.
